0

我正在尝试编写将信息发送到 SQL 的脚本,但是提交按钮和表单收音机有问题,有人可以帮我吗?

这个 IF 不能正常工作

if (isset($_POST['test'])) {
if(isset( $_POST['odp']))

这是 PHP http://wklej.org/id/1003412/的所有代码

4

2 回答 2

0

一方面,在查看您的代码后,您似乎最好将这两个 if 结合起来,如下所示:

if ((isset($_POST['test']) && isset( $_POST['odp']))
{
    code to execute;
}

你得到 isset($_POST['test']) 和 isset($_POST['odp']) 的值是多少?您可能想尝试将它们呼应出来,看看它们是否是您期望的实际值。您也可以尝试在两个 if(isset 之后立即回显某些内容,因为它可能是已执行代码的一部分不起作用,而不是实际的 if 语句。

empty($_POST['test']) 也可能效果更好,与上述海报相同。

于 2013-04-05T18:24:40.410 回答
0

对于标题,在您提供的代码中,您当前已将该行注释掉。另一个提示是,必须在输出任何内容之前完成标头重定向,您目前在打印行和一些回显行之后拥有它。要解决此问题,您可以将其移至所有其他代码之上的函数,然后在需要时调用该函数。

编辑:这是为了回答此页面上发布的最后一个问题。

于 2013-04-10T16:13:30.467 回答